San Luis Rey River

Highlight • River

This is the end point for the 69 mile long San Luis Rey River, stretching from it's headwaters in the Palomar Mountains all the way through Cleveland National Forest to the Santa Rosa Mountains

Tin Fish at Oceanside Pier

Highlight • Restaurant

The 600 meter long pier is the longest wooden pier on the American west coast. It has existed in its current form since 1925. It is visited by many hikers …
